Output c5f151efe7da7efd43bcb5c38fd8d5ecf6bed28a53d1abd29ae59568545649d5:77
- value
- 503966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cedfb7207909e245bd1363f07c5554948d0d1ac OP_EQUAL
- address
- 34KywD4VAuaWLgoGdDb32Dnus7wNnQj86A
- transaction
- c5f151efe7da7efd43bcb5c38fd8d5ecf6bed28a53d1abd29ae59568545649d5